Sports medicine basically deals with injuries of the musculoskeletal system. This system is composed of muscles, bones, joints, ligaments and tendons together with associated nerves and blood vessels. Specialists in this field usually obtain a basic undergraduate degree in medicine before focusing on sports related disorders. It is important for the specialist to clearly know the anatomy of the human body in order to decipher what particular part has been injured.

Knee injuries are the commonest, particularly in the world of soccer and rugby. These two games involve a lot of running around and one can end up sustaining injuries in the event of slippage or being hit by the opponent. A certain ligament referred to as the anterior cruciate ligament is particularly vulnerable to injury when the knee gets twisted abnormally.

The knee is usually a common target when it comes to physical injuries during sports, particularly activities that involve aggression such as in rugby. Football players may also be injured as they tackle each other in a bid to pass the ball forward. The anterior cruciate ligament, ACL, is one of the soft tissues that routinely comes in the way of harm.

Apart from lower limb injuries, the head is also susceptible to getting physically hurt. A player may be directly hit by an opponent, a tool for play (such as a ball, baseball bat or hockey stick) or may fall down with direct impact to the head. Depending on mode and severity of injury, different structures in the head may be affected.

When the anterior cruciate ligament gets injured, the person may not be able to play in the field anymore. This is because they are at a risk of worsening the tear. In addition, the knee joint loses control and one may not play as is required of them. Furthermore, victims are usually uncomfortable and in excruciating pain. Among the initial things to do is to provide extra support for the knee by applying a splint. If the pain is too much to bear, appropriate pain medication should be administered. Sportsmen whose ligaments get torn are usually required to stay away from the field for a given period of time so that the soft tissues can heal. In selected cases, an operation may be needed.

Every injury to the head should be given maximum attention to ensure that no complications develop as a result of negligence. It is prudent that head injuries be investigated fully to ensure that there are no internal soft injuries in cases where the person has not sustained any external physical injury. Other than damage to soft tissues, the victim may also end up with fractures of the skull bone.

The head can be protected by use of protective helmets in games that require it. The knees are usually protected using knee pads. In games such as baseball, the chest is guarded using special gear worn around the chest.
